The 48th GA flag captured at Gettysburg was the regimental flag - not a company standard. It was lost in the July 2nd charge by Wright's Brigade upon Cemetery Ridge. The Pickett - Pettigrew - Trimble charge took place the following day on July 3rd, on pretty much the same ground. The 48th GA flag is in the collection housed at the Georgia State Capitol building in Atlanta.
